About 2,3-bis[[(9Z,12Z)-octadeca-9,12-dienoyl]oxy]propyl dotriacontanoate

2,3-bis[[(9Z,12Z)-octadeca-9,12-dienoyl]oxy]propyl dotriacontanoate (PubChem CID 165223820) has the molecular formula C71H130O6 and a molecular weight of 1079.81 g/mol. Its IUPAC name is 2,3-bis[[(9Z,12Z)-octadeca-9,12-dienoyl]oxy]propyl dotriacontanoate.
